academic departments: Lowercase except for words that are proper nouns or adjectives. The marketing department; the department of English.

ballpoint pen: Proper style for students’ writing instruments.

bus, buses: Proper style for the transportation vehicles. The verb forms: bus, bused and busing. Add an extra s, and you’re insinuating kissing.

chapter: Capitalize when used with a numeral in reference to a section of a book or legal code. Always use Arabic figures. Chapter 1, Chapter 20. Lowercase when standing alone. The book chapters are short.

day care: Two words, no hyphen in all uses.

dean’s list: Lowercase in all uses. He is on the dean’s list for fall semester. She is a dean’s list student.

encyclopedia: Lowercase, but follow the spelling of formal names: Encyclopedia Britannica.
